WebOffshore, the surface roughness length is dependent on sea state, increasing with the local wave conditions, which are in turn influenced by wind conditions. However, this relationship is complex, as the sea surface, even when rough, does not present fixed roughness elements such as trees, hills and buildings, as tends to be the case onshore.
